Do you enjoy getting hands-on with AV equipment and figuring out what’s gone wrong? Are you comfortable working with schematics, tools, and customers in a busy, practical environment? SBS Audio Visual is a collaborative, team-driven business supporting events, rentals, repairs, installations, and retail. We are looking for an Electronics Service and Repair Technician to join our workshop and become a key part of what we do.
This is a hands-on position within our workshop, ideal for someone with a background in sound, lighting, or vision—especially within live events. You will spend your time repairing and servicing a wide range of audio, video, and lighting equipment, particularly DJ and sound gear. Alongside the technical work, you will speak with customers, keep track of repairs, and help keep the workshop running smoothly. There may also be the occasional opportunity to work on-site.
Key Responsibilities- Repair and service AV equipment down to component level
- Diagnose faults using a logical and practical approach
- Work from schematic diagrams and use tools such as multimeters and oscilloscopes
- Carry out soldering work on a variety of components
- Provide clear and timely repair quotes
- Speak with customers by phone, email, and in person
- Order parts and keep stock organised
- Support spare parts sales
- Carry out PAT testing
- Keep the workshop clean, organised, and efficient
At SBS Audio Visual, teamwork really matters. We support each other, share knowledge, and work together to get the job done. It is a busy environment, but one where people take pride in their work and enjoy what they do.
